“Yu-Gi-Oh! Card Game” 25th Anniversary Project Begins

Konami Digitial Entertainment Co., Ltd., in the run up to the 25th anniversary of the “Yu-Gi-Oh! Official Card Game: Duel Monsters”, on February 4th, 2024, will start its 25th Anniversary Project during February 2023.

The Yu-Gi-Oh! Official Card Game was launched by Konami Digital Entertainment on February 1999, and has been beloved by our customers for a quarter century. With the overseas “Yu-Gi-Oh! Trading Card Game”, the new product series “Yu-Gi-Oh! Rush Duel”, and various Digital Titles, the “Yu-Gi-Oh! Card Game” continues to create history.

Therefore, this year’s event, which marks a massive milestone, the 25th Anniversary of the Yu-Gi-Oh! Card Game, will include various Yu-Gi-Oh! products and Digital Titles(*). We are planning various projects in Japan and overseas, such as the release of anniversary related products, as well as campaigns and sweepstakes for fans to look forward to.

Before the project kicks off, we have opened a special website for the 25th anniversary. Information about the anniversary will be updated on this website occasionally.
